    Description

    Position Summary

    Wolfsburg West is seeking a detail-oriented Accounting & Operations Specialist to oversee the company's day-to-day accounting functions while supporting key operational processes. This role is responsible for maintaining accurate financial records, managing payroll and insurance administration, overseeing AP/AR, supporting month-end and year-end close, and coordinating purchasing and freight documentation. The ideal candidate is highly organized, enjoys wearing multiple hats, and thrives in a small business environment where accuracy, initiative, and collaboration are valued.


    Key Responsibilities

    Accounting & Finance

    • Process bi-weekly payroll and maintain payroll records.
    • Manage accounts payable, including invoice processing, vendor payments, and reconciliations.
    • Oversee accounts receivable, customer invoicing, collections, and payment application.
    • Perform daily cash reconciliation and bank deposits.
    • Manage banking relationships and complete bank reconciliations.
    • Prepare operational journal entries and maintain the general ledger.
    • Assist with month-end and year-end close, including reconciliations and supporting schedules.
    • Support Fractional Controller with tax preparation and annual financial reporting.
    • Maintain accurate financial records and documentation.

    Tax & Compliance

    • Prepare and file multi-state sales tax returns using Avalara.
    • Coordinate business licenses and ensure ongoing compliance.
    • Assist with tax documentation and support external accountants during tax season.

    Human Resources & Benefits Administration

    • Administer employee health insurance benefits and enrollments.
    • Manage business insurance policies, renewals, certificates of insurance, and claims coordination.
    • Support onboarding paperwork and payroll-related employee changes.

    Purchasing & Operations

    • Create and manage purchase orders.
    • Coordinate inbound international freight and shipping documentation.
    • Prepare Shipper's Letters of Instruction (SLIs) and customs documentation.
    • Work with freight forwarders, customs brokers, and vendors to ensure timely deliveries.
    • Maintain purchasing records and vendor files.
    • Identify opportunities to improve accounting and operational processes.

    Qualifications

    • 5+ years of accounting or bookkeeping experience, preferably in a manufacturing, distribution, or e-commerce environment.
    • Strong understanding of GAAP and accounting principles.
    • Experience processing payroll and administering employee benefits.
    • Experience with accounts payable, accounts receivable, bank reconciliations, and general ledger accounting.
    • Experience supporting month-end and year-end close.
    • Knowledge of sales tax compliance; Avalara experience preferred.
    • Experience coordinating international freight or import documentation is a plus.
    • Excellent organizational skills and attention to detail.
    • Strong Excel skills and proficiency with accounting software.
    • Ability to manage multiple priorities independently while maintaining accuracy.
